In this report, LP Information covers the present scenario (with the base year being 2017) and the growth prospects of global Professional Skincare Products market for 2018-2023.

Professional Skincare Products, as known, is a professional products to protect the skin. According to the effect of professional skincare products, it can be divided into Anti-Aging, Anti-Pigmentation, Anti-Dehydration, Sun Protection and so on.
Professional Skincare Products industry has much fragmented, manufacturers are mostly in the Europe and USA. Among them, Europe Production value accounted for less than 36.35% of the total value of global Professional Skincare Products in 2015. L’Oreal is the world leading manufacturer in global Professional Skincare Products market with the market share of 5.30% in 2015.
Compared to 2014, Professional Skincare Products market managed to increase sales by 3.55% to 9.15 Billion USD worldwide in 2015. Overall, the Professional Skincare Products performance is positive, despite the weak economic environment.
Over the next five years, LPI(LP Information) projects that Professional Skincare Products will register a 4.8% CAGR in terms of revenue, reach US$ 13300 million by 2023, from US$ 10000 million in 2017.
